Vintage original 9.25 x 12.25 in. US sheet music from the 1920's Paris-set gigolo-themed war drama/romance, GIGOLO, released in 1926 by Producers Distributing Corporation (PDC) and directed by William K. Howard.

 

The song is entitled Gigolo, with lyric by Marian Gillespie and music by John Milton Hagen, and the front cover depicts Rod La Rocque dancing with a blonde. Published by M. Witmark Sons (N.Y.), it consists of 6 pages and is in fine condition.

 

*"Gigolo is a 1926 American silent romance drama film produced by Cecil B. DeMille and released by Producers Distributing Corporation. William K. Howard directed and Rod La Rocque and Jobyna Ralstonstar. The film is based on a novel, Gigolo, by Edna Ferber. Prints survive of this silent feature."

*"The heir to a family business travels to Paris to try to stop his youth-obsessed mother from squandering the family fortune with her new husband, who's married her for her money. After he returns from service in World War I, he finds his mother, now broke and abandoned by her gigolo husband. In an ironic turn of events, he winds-up squiring rich old women around Paris' nightlife, becoming the kind of gigolo he tried to save his mother from. Things take a turn for the worse when some family friends from back home turn-up in Paris and see what has become of him."
